No specifics have been provided, but Comodo Dragon 33 is now available for download for Windows users, providing them with an alternative browsing solution for computers powered by Microsoft's operating system.

Comodo Dragon 33 is mostly aimed at fixing bugs and improving performance, so no new features are available, but users who were running it already should still deploy the new version as soon as possible.

As you know, Comodo Dragon 33 is a browser based on Chromium and although it's not as popular as some other apps on the market, it still has an impressive feature lineup. Its look is very similar to Google Chrome's, while its features include options to organize bookmarks, add new themes and extensions, developer tools, and a download manager.

The browser obviously works on Windows exclusively and comes with support for all versions of the operating system, including Windows XP, which no longer receives updates from Microsoft.

Update: Comodo has just provided some new details on this new release, revealing that Dragon 33 comes with Drag & Drop add-on version 2.0 and PrivDog 2.1.0.22, while the entire browser is based on Chromium 33.0.1750.112. Some issues have also been confirmed, including bugs that make the Google page translation service not to work in this version.
